Jamshedpur, April 7: Good news for railway passengers. Keeping in view the demand of the passengers, South Eastern Railway has decided to provide experiment stoppage of various express trains at Rengali which falls under the East Coast Railway.
According to a notification issued by the SER headquarters -12871/12872 Howrah-Titlagarh-Howrah Express, 18452/18451 Puri-Hatia-Puri Express and 13351/13352 Dhanbad-Alappuzha Express will stop at Rengali on an experimental basis for six months from today.
The 12871 Howrah-Titlagarh Express will arrive in Rengali at 3.20 pm and depart at 3.22 pm.
In the opposite direction, 12872 Titlagarh-Howrah Express will arrive at Rengali at 8.40 am and will depart at 8.42 am.
The 18452 Puri-Hatia Express will arrive in Rengali at 4.40 am and depart at 4.42 am.
In the opposite direction, 18451 Hatia-Puri Express will arrive in Rengali at 9.40 am and will depart at 9.42 pm.
The 13351 Dhanbad-Alappuzha Express will arrive in Rengali at 10.03 pm and depart at 10.05 pm.
In the opposite direction, 13352 Alappuzha-Dhanbad Express will arrive in Rengali at 11.33 pm and will depart at 11.35 pm.
Railway officials at Garden Reach said depending on the response and revenue earning, the stoppages would be converted into permanent ones on an experimental basis.
